Transponder Chip Key

The transponder chip key is an automotive security device that relays an unique code to the car's immobilizer when it's inserted into the ignition. The immobilizer will then block the vehicle's starter motor, fuel pump and any other system that could permit it to run it wasn't for the chip's identification code.

The batteries in most key fobs must be changed every two years, or if you notice they aren't working as well. The positive thing is that you can replace the battery of your key fob on your own at a fraction of the cost that you would pay to have a locksmith or dealer take care of it. The battery type that you require is a CR-2032, and you can get them at most hardware stores or big-box retailers.

Only a locksmith for cars or a dealer has the special programming machine needed to program some key fobs. Some keys do not come with transponder chips and therefore they don't need programming.
